What Is the Arb Fast Lane Protocol?
It’s a high-performance, onchain execution engine built to resolve fragmented pricing across decentralized markets.
Designed for speed, precision, and chain-wide scope, it actively restores price equilibrium by scanning and executing arbitrage opportunities across major DEXes on the network — with precision down to the quadrillionths.
It serves two essential roles:
1. A Built-in Solver System for Carbon DeFi
Though Carbon DeFi, Bancor’s flagship DEX, isn’t yet deployed on Arbitrum, the groundwork is being laid. Once a Carbon DeFi deployment goes live on Arbitrum, every strategy created will be supported by the Arb Fast Lane’s built-in solver system. That means real-time, onchain execution.
It works like this:
• Once a strategy is created on Carbon DeFi, it becomes instantly visible to the Arb Fast Lane, which scans Arbitrum for available liquidity and profitable execution paths.
• From there, trades are fulfilled with precision — using chain-wide liquidity.

2. A Chain-Wide Arbitrage Framework
Independently, the Arb Fast Lane plays a critical role in keeping Arbitrum’s markets healthy.
By executing trades across fragmented liquidity, the Arb Fast Lane:
• Aligns token prices across Arbitrum
• Keeps capital in motion
• Sustains activity across all major DEXes

The Technology Behind It
Most arbitrage models used in DeFi today struggle with speed and scale. They rely on outdated optimization models that were never designed for the fragmented, nonlinear dynamics of modern AMMs– especially concentrated liquidity environments and Carbon DeFi’s Asymmetric Liquidity.
Bancor’s approach — Marginal Price Optimization — zeroes in on the marginal price frontier, where optimal trades naturally occur. It skips the unnecessary complexity that bogs down traditional models, allowing for faster, more scalable execution.
The result?
• 200x faster execution
• Scalability across any AMM model
• Unmatched computational efficiency

Why Arbitrum?
Since its launch in 2021, Arbitrum has consistently ranked as a leading Layer 2 scaling solution and remains one of the most actively developed ecosystems in Ethereum’s rollup-centric roadmap.
Accoring to Messari, at the time of writing, Arbitrum boasts:
• Over $2.11 billion in TVL — 2nd largest Ethereum L2
• More than 2.2 million daily transactions
• Over 270,000 daily active addresses
• Nearly 800 dApps deployed

Where It’s Live

Upon launch, the Arb Fast Lane is already operating across many of Arbitrum’s top DEXes, including:
Uniswap v2, v3, and v4
PancakeSwap v2 and v3
SushiSwap v2 and v3
Arbswap v2
Smardex v2
Kaleido Cube v2
Spartadex v2
Zyberswap v2
